Output 3665bdf2e28c3c7a564b4e5c36880c7afc870bbce365c709e7ec1e229f482683:11

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3527dacafc1ae9653c19faa73747edc0025257c8 OP_EQUAL
address
36Y5UrtuqEYzNZuYPxUmUMMo3WaSP5x93F
transaction
3665bdf2e28c3c7a564b4e5c36880c7afc870bbce365c709e7ec1e229f482683